Berfusra is a Kurdish singer-songwriter, poet, drag king, and performance artist from Turkey, currently based in Berlin, Germany. With a background in English Literature and a master’s degree in Cultural Studies and American Literature underway, Berfusra brings academic rigor and emotional depth into their practice. As a genderfluid artist, their work explores identity politics through a powerful blend of live vocals, movement, theatrical performance, and poetry. Rooted in radical vulnerability and storytelling, Berfusra’s performances address themes of race, immigration, queerness, womanhood, gender, class, love, loss, longing, desire, and complex trauma. Drawing on their own lived experiences, they create spaces where openness becomes both a tool for survival and a catalyst for connection. Since relocating to Germany in 2023, Berfusra has performed across multiple mediums and stages, including SO36, Festsaal Kreuzberg, Ballhaus Prinzenallee, Volksbühne, and Aeden. They have been featured in events and festivals such as Proud Haram Festival (2024, 2025), Garbicz Festival (2024), Gayhane (2025), and Blade Festival (2025), and have taken part in projects like König Drag Show (2023) and Dyke High: Magic Dyke* (2025). Through a deeply personal yet politically charged artistic lens, Berfusra continues to challenge boundaries, celebrate fluidity, and give voice to untold stories.
